Subject: Fanout cut-over done

Welcome aboard. Quick summary: we moved the Pelthorn notification fan-out to the new queue-backed dispatcher last night. The old path buffered unboundedly under load; the new one applies backpressure at the subscriber edge, so slow consumers no longer stall the whole pipeline. Latency p99 dropped from 4.2s to 800ms during the morning burst. These are the settings we landed on after tuning in staging.

config for kafof-bawef:
holath:
  log_level: debug
  metrics_host: metrics.holath.qorvelsys.internal
  pin: 2191
  pool_size: 32

- [ ] **Step 7: Breaker override escrow.** After sealing the signing keys for the Tallgrove upstream API circuit breaker, confirm the support team can force the breaker open during a full outage. The override bundle lives in the sealed escrow drawer and is useless without its unlock phrase. Two ceremony witnesses must initial this step before proceeding. The escrow bundle is decrypted with the recovery passphrase that follows.

vault phrase of kahip-kahop = holath-quenmir

Leadership Review Briefing — Eastreach Expansion

For branch managers: Varentide Holdings has completed feasibility work on expansion into the Eastreach coastal region. Two pilot branches are proposed, one in Marlow Quay and one in Selverton. Staffing models assume local hiring with a six-week training cycle run from the Dunmere hub. Regulatory filings are underway; capital allocation is approved in principle. Timelines will be confirmed at the leadership review. The confidential planning note that follows is for this audience only.

internal memo for kaduf-baduf: Only 35 of the 378 pilot accounts renewed Holir, so a churn review is set for June 11. Eliielax Group is in early talks to buy Silaelix Group for about $142.1 million.

## TICKET-4471: Expired credential blocking canary gate checks

The canary gating job for the Ledgermere deploy pipeline failed overnight because its credential for the internal Gatekeep service expired. New team members: gating rules won't evaluate until this is rotated, so promotions are frozen. A replacement key has been issued and is pasted below.

app token of kafop-hahaf = kto11_iRLdsMBafGn